Dr. Julia Shamshina | Polymer Chemistry | Editorial Board Member
Associate Professor | Texas Tech University | United States
Dr. Julia Shamshina is a leading researcher in ionic liquids, biopolymers, and green chemistry, with a focus on sustainable processing of chitin, cellulose, and other renewable materials for high-value industrial applications. Her work bridges fundamental chemistry and practical material development, contributing to biodegradable polymers, bio-based composites, and advanced functional materials. She has published over 110 documents, with 5,210 citations on Scopus (h-index 41) and 7,602 citations on Google Scholar (h-index 46, i10-index 101), reflecting her significant impact in sustainable chemistry, biopolymer engineering, and industrial-scale green technologies.
